Kirby Files wrote on 02/28/2007 08:20 PM: > Andrew Stevens wrote on 02/28/2007 07:26 PM: >>> BTW, I'm using xdoclet-1.2.3 from the stable download. >> >> That's your problem - the patches to xjavadoc were done since that >> release. There is no current xdoclet release that includes them, but if >> you can build a newer xjavadoc jar from CVS you should be able to just >> swap it instead of the one in the xdoclet distribution. > > Thanks for the suggestion. I've built the newer xjavadoc from CVS, which > compiled as "xjavadoc-1.5-snapshot.jar". I used this in place of the > 1.2.3 xjavadoc in xdoclet's classpath, and I still get: > > [jmxdoclet] (XDocletMain.start 47 ) Running > <mbeaninterface/> > [jmxdoclet] Error parsing File
Sorry, I'm the fool. During some testing of xdoclet, I had installed the xjavadoc jar to ANT_HOME/lib, and forgotten it. That was superseding the newer xjavadoc.jar in my xdoclet.classpath. After fixing that, the parser works correctly, with no errors. ...Now I just have to go figure out how to properly annotate my file to get a decent jboss-service.xml.
